Taster #5887 · Nov 7, 2014
The wine is clear and bright with a medium garnet colour and presence of legs. The nose is clean and developing, showing medium(+) intensity aromas of tobacco, earth, mushrooms, baked plums, liquorice, vanilla, chocolate and coconut. The wine is dry in the mouth with a medium(+) refreshing acidity. It has medium ripe fine-grained tannins and a medium alcohol. It has a medium body and medium(+) intensity flavours of tobacco, mushrooms, baked plums, liquorice, chocolate, vanilla and coconut. The finish is …

Taster #5845 · Jun 7, 2004
NobleRottersSydney - NOT Oz/NZ/France/Italy (Lucio's, Paddington) : Brick red. A slightly pungent, earthy sour nose. Faintly oxidative notes appear as well. Sweetish, almost fizzy tannins on the palate. A bit leathery in texture – good weight through to the mid-palate. Somewhat traditional Rioja with only moderate oak influence. Attractive for a modest rioja, but unlikely to improve much I think.
